Job Overview




  • The Laboratory Technician will be responsible for the repair, maintenance, testing, and troubleshooting of solar boxes and related electronic components.

  • The role requires strong expertise in electronics engineering, hands-on technical skills, and the ability to support field and technical teams in resolving complex faults.

  • The technician will ensure all repaired units meet quality, safety, and performance standards before deployment.



Key Responsibilities

Technical & Repair Duties:




  • Diagnose, troubleshoot, and repair faulty solar boxes and associated electronic components.

  • Perform preventive and corrective maintenance on solar systems and lab equipment.

  • Conduct functional testing, validation, and quality checks on repaired units.

  • Identify root causes of failures and recommend corrective actions.

  • Replace, rework, or refurbish defective components in line with repair standards.



Laboratory Operations:




  • Maintain a clean, organized, and safe laboratory environment.

  • Properly use and maintain diagnostic tools, testing equipment, and soldering devices.

  • Document repair activities, test results, and fault reports accurately.

  • Ensure compliance with safety procedures and technical standards.



Technical Support & Collaboration:




  • Provide technical support to field technicians and the wider technical team.

  • Assist in resolving escalated technical issues from operations or customer support teams.

  • Share technical knowledge and best practices with team members.

  • Support training of junior technicians when required.

  • Track repaired units, spare parts usage, and failure trends.

  • Escalate recurring or critical faults to management with clear technical analysis.



Qualifications & Experience




  • OND / HND / B.Sc. in Electronics Engineering, Electrical Engineering, or a related field.

  • 1-3 years of work experience.

  • Proven experience in electronics repair, troubleshooting, and maintenance.

  • Experience working with solar systems, power electronics, or embedded systems is an added advantage.
